Angular movements are produced when the angle between the bones of joint changes. There are several different types of angular movements, including flexion, extension, hyperextension, abduction, adduction, and circumduction. Flexion, or bending, occurs when the angle between the bones decreases. Moving the forearm upward at the elbow or moving the wrist to move the hand toward the forearm are examples of flexion. The extension is the opposite of flexion in that the angle between the bones of a joint increase.
